Web17 jul. 2005 · Record the weight on each scale. Drop a plumb bob down from the datum. Mark its spot on the floor as shown in Photo 5. Drop the plumb bob from each wheel’s axle, in turn. Mark each of those spots on the floor. Measure the longitudinal (nose-to-tail) distance from the datum to each of the axles.
